The Role

This position is responsible for acting as the primary relationship contact for MCAP's strategic Broker partners. The Broker Relationship Manager will focus their attention on assembling and growing a portfolio of brokers, developing relationships with and providing them with high levels of service including underwriting activities.

The Broker Relationship Manager will be accountable for the annual achievement of specific targets set at the beginning of each fiscal year.

Underwriting
  • Contribute to the effective processing and approval of mortgage applications by:
  • Effectively communicating company's lending policy and procedures to brokers; so that Brokers have a thorough knowledge of our lending requirements, and qualifying parameters.
  • Determining and obtaining all pertinent credit information such as proof of income, down payment confirmation and etc., and conducting appropriate due diligence thereon in order to meet credit and quality standards, including anti-money laundering and anti-terrorist financing standards and maintain desired reputation.
  • Issuing and following-up on commitments.
  • Obtaining Mortgage Insurer approval for insured loans.
  • Ordering and reviewing appraisals for all conventional mortgages.
  • Monitor mortgage broker activities and bring any activities which appear worthy of further investigation to the attention of appropriate officers.
  • Adjudicate information presented and address any discrepancies or inconsistencies.
  • Document the deal and write up rationale to support recommendation for approval.
  • Condition the deal in accordance with the recommendation for approval.
  • Delivers quick and creative mortgage solutions in order to structure files in order to meet company guidelines.

MCAPis Canada's largest independent MortgageFinance company withover $150 billion in assets under management providing mortgage solutions forresidential and commercial properties. For over 35 years,MCAP originates, trades, securitizes and services mortgages in offices acrossCanada. MCAP originates residential mortgages exclusively through the mortgagebroker channel as we believe that a professional mortgage broker is aconsumer's best option and MCAP actively promotes the services of mortgagebrokers across the country. MCAP is also a leader in the Canadian residentialconstruction lending market with over 25 years in the business. Our teams ofdedicated professionals serve a variety of developer, construction and lenderclients across Canada.
